2. Set up Bills

Set up bills signify a significant factor of the entire value related to buying a positron emission tomography (PET) scanner. These bills lengthen past the preliminary buy value of the gear and embody a number of essential features that have to be factored into funds planning. Understanding the scope of set up bills is crucial for precisely assessing the general monetary dedication required for integrating PET imaging capabilities.

Website preparation typically constitutes a considerable portion of set up prices. PET scanners require specialised amenities that meet stringent shielding necessities to make sure radiation security for each sufferers and employees. Modifications to present infrastructure, similar to reinforcing flooring to help the scanner’s weight or developing shielded rooms, contribute considerably to those prices. For instance, a newly constructed facility would possibly require lead-lined partitions and specialised air flow techniques, including significantly to the general set up funds. In present amenities, adapting areas to accommodate the scanner’s footprint and shielding requirements can contain demolition and reconstruction, additional growing bills.

Specialised gear set up provides to the general value. This consists of the exact positioning and calibration of the scanner, in addition to the mixing of related {hardware} and software program elements. The complexity of the set up course of necessitates the involvement of educated technicians and engineers, typically supplied by the producer, additional contributing to the expense. The set up of ancillary gear, similar to energy mills or cooling techniques required for optimum scanner efficiency, additionally elements into the entire value. Moreover, connecting the PET scanner to the power’s community and integrating it with present image archiving and communication techniques (PACS) provides to the complexity and price of the set up course of.

  • Radiotracers

    Radiotracers, important for PET imaging, represent a considerable recurring expense. The price of radiotracers varies relying on the precise sort required for various diagnostic procedures, the frequency of use, and provider pricing. Managing radiotracer prices requires cautious stock management, environment friendly scheduling, and probably exploring choices for on-site cyclotron manufacturing for generally used tracers to cut back reliance on exterior suppliers.

  • Staffing

    Specialised personnel are important for working and sustaining a PET scanner, decoding photographs, and administering radiotracers. Staffing prices embody salaries, advantages, and ongoing coaching to take care of proficiency with evolving applied sciences and protocols. Optimizing staffing ranges and guaranteeing environment friendly workflow processes are essential for managing personnel bills whereas sustaining high-quality imaging providers.
